Global Ice Age Climate Patterns Influenced by Bering Strait

Small geographic feature has large impacts on climate

In a vivid example of how a small geographic feature may have far-reaching impacts on climate, new research shows that water levels in the Bering Strait helped drive global climate patterns during ice age episodes dating back more than 100,000 years.

The international study, led by scientists at the National Center for Atmospheric Research (NCAR) in Boulder, Colo., found that the repeated opening and closing of the narrow strait due to fluctuating sea levels affected currents that transported heat and salinity in the Atlantic and Pacific Oceans.

As a result, summer temperatures in parts of North America and Greenland oscillated between comparatively warm and cold phases, causing ice sheets to alternate between expansion and retreat and affecting sea levels worldwide.

While the findings do not directly bear on current global warming, according to Steve Nelson, National Science Foundation (NSF) program director for NCAR, they highlight the complexity of Earth’s climate system and the fact that seemingly insignificant changes can lead to dramatic tipping points for climate patterns, especially in and around the Arctic.

“The global climate is sensitive to impacts that may seem minor,” says NCAR scientist Aixue Hu, the project’s lead scientist. “Even small processes, if they are in the right location, can amplify changes in climate around the world.”

The research results are published this week in the journal Nature Geoscience.

Funded by NSF and the U.S. Department of Energy, the scientists used the latest generation of supercomputers to study past climate at a level of detail that would have been impossible just a few years ago.

Hu and his colleagues set out to solve a key mystery of the last glacial period: Why, starting about 116,000 years ago, did northern ice sheets repeatedly advance and retreat for about the next 70,000 years? The enormous ice sheets held so much water that sea levels rose and dropped by as much as about 100 feet (30 meters) during these intervals.

In other cases, scientists have associated such major oscillations in climate with fluctuations in Earth’s orbit around the Sun. But in the time period the research team looked at, the orbital pattern did not correspond with the geologic movement of the ice sheets and associated sea level changes.

The researchers considered an alternative possibility: that changes in the Bering Strait, the main gateway in the Northern Hemisphere between the Atlantic and Pacific Oceans, might have affected ocean currents across much of the globe.

Although small–the strait is currently about 50 miles (80 kilometers) wide between Russia and the westernmost islands of Alaska–it allows water to circulate from the relatively fresh north Pacific to the saltier north Atlantic via the Arctic Ocean. This flow is instrumental to regulating the strength of a current known as the meridional overturning circulation, a key driver of heat from the tropics to the poles.

Using the NCAR-based Community Climate System Model, a powerful computer tool for studying worldwide climate, the researchers compared the responses of ice age climate to conditions in the Bering Strait.

They ran the model on new supercomputers at NCAR and the Department of Energy’s Oak Ridge National Laboratory, enabling them to focus on smaller-scale geographic features that, until recently, could not be captured in long-term simulations of global climate.

The simulations accounted for the changes in sea level, revealing a recurring pattern–each time playing out over several thousand years–in which the reopening and closing of the strait had a far-reaching impact on ocean currents and ice sheets.

As the climate cooled because of changes in Earth’s orbit, northern ice sheets expanded. This caused sea levels to drop worldwide, forming a land bridge from Asia to North America and nearly closing the Bering Strait.

With the flow of comparatively fresh water from the Pacific to the Atlantic choked off, the Atlantic grew more saline. The saltier and heavier water led to an intensification of the Atlantic’s meridional overturning circulation, a current of rising and sinking water that, like a conveyor belt, pumps warmer water northward from the tropics.

This circulation warmed Greenland and parts of North America by about 3 degrees Fahrenheit (1.5 degrees Celsius)–enough to reverse the advance of ice sheets in those regions and reduce their height by almost 400 feet (112 meters) every thousand years. Although the Pacific cooled by an equivalent amount, it did not have vast ice sheets that could be affected by the change in climate.

Over thousands of years, the Greenland and North American ice sheets melted enough to raise sea levels and reopen the Bering Strait.

The new inflow of fresher water from the Pacific weakened the meridional overturning circulation, allowing North America and Greenland to cool over time. The ice sheets resumed their advance, sea levels dropped, the Bering Strait again mostly closed, and the entire cycle was repeated.

The combination of the ocean circulation and the size of the ice sheets–which exerted a cooling effect by reflecting sunlight back into space–affected climate throughout the world.

The computer simulations showed that North America and Eurasia warmed significantly during the times when the Bering Strait was open, with the tropical and subtropical Indian and Pacific Oceans, as well as Antarctica, warming slightly.

The pattern was finally broken about 34,000 years ago, the point in Earth’s 95,000-year orbital cycle at which the planet was so far from the Sun at certain times of year that the ice sheets continued to grow even when the Bering Strait closed.

When the orbital cycle brought Earth closer to the Sun in the northern winter, the ice sheets retreated sufficiently about 10,000 years ago to reopen the strait. This helped lead to a relatively stable climate, nurturing the rise of civilization.

On the Tibetan Plateau, temperatures are rising and glaciers are melting faster than climate scientists would expect based on global warming alone. A recent study of ice cores from five Tibetan glaciers by NASA and Chinese scientists confirmed the likely culprit: rapid increases in black soot concentrations since the 1990s, mostly from air pollution sources over Asia, especially the Indian subcontinent. Soot-darkened snow and glaciers absorb sunlight, which hastens melting, adding to the impact of global warming.

NASA climate scientists combine satellite and ground-based observations of soot and other particles in the air with weather and air chemistry models to study how the atmosphere moves pollution from one place to another. This image is from a computer simulation of the spread of black soot (“black carbon” to climate scientists) over the Tibetan Plateau from August through November 2009. It shows black carbon aerosol optical thickness on September 26, 2009. (Aerosol optical thickness is scale that describes how much pollution was in the air based on how much of the incoming sunlight the particles absorbed.) Places where the air was thick with soot are white, while lower concentrations are transparent purple.

The highest concentrations of black soot are in the right-hand side of the image, over the densely populated coastal plain of China. But high concentrations occur over India, as well, and the black soot spreads across the southern arc of the Tibetan Plateau, which is defined by the towering peaks of the Himalaya Mountains. (Note: Topography has been exaggerated to highlight features that influence air movement). The animation shows how the black carbon pollution from India often circulates at high concentrations for several days against the base of the Himalaya, periodically “sloshing” over the rim of the mountains and spilling northward over the plateau, before being carried away over the Bay of Bengal or the Arabian Sea.

Writing about the implications of the study for the Goddard Institute for Space Studies Website, NASA climate scientist and study co-author James Hansen said, “[C]ontinued, ‘business-as-usual’ emissions of greenhouse gases and black soot will result in the loss of most Himalayan glaciers this century, with devastating effects on fresh water supplies in dry seasons. The black soot arises especially from diesel engines, coal use without effective scrubbers, and biomass burning, including cook stoves. Reduction of black soot via cleaner energies would have other benefits for human health and agricultural productivity. However, survival of the glaciers also requires halting global warming, which depends upon stabilizing and reducing greenhouse gases, especially carbon dioxide.”

Atmospheric Temperature Trends, 1979-2005

Posted July 6, 2007

Atmospheric Temperature Trends, 1979-2005

Climate models predict that the build up of greenhouse gases should warm the lower layer of the atmosphere, called the troposphere, and cool the layer above it, the stratosphere. Greenhouse gases accumulate in the troposphere where they absorb energy radiated from the Earth and re-emit energy back to the surface. Because the gases trap heat in the lower parts of the atmosphere, the stratosphere cools down. This pattern of warming in the lower atmosphere and cooling in the stratosphere is a hallmark of greenhouse gas warming in global climate models.

These images show temperature trends in two thick layers of the atmosphere as measured by a series of satellite-based instruments between January 1979 and December 2005. The top image shows temperatures in the middle troposphere, centered around 5 kilometers above the surface. The lower image shows temperatures in the lower stratosphere, centered around 18 kilometers above the surface. Oranges and yellows dominate the troposphere image, indicating that the air nearest the Earth’s surface warmed during the period. The stratosphere image is dominated by blues and greens, indicating cooling.

Globally, the troposphere warmed, and the stratosphere cooled during this period. Local trends varied. The greatest tropospheric warming was in the Arctic, where warming is amplified as snow and ice melt. The Antarctic, on the other hand, showed cooling. Some researchers have explained the localized cooling as a side effect of the ozone hole on atmospheric circulation over Antarctica. Loss of ozone cools the stratosphere, a change which intensifies the vortex of winds that encircle the continent. The stronger vortex isolates the air over the continent, cooling the stratosphere even further. At different times of the year, the unusually cold air dips down from the stratosphere and into the troposphere.

The cooling trend in the stratosphere was probably not solely due to greenhouse gas warming at lower altitudes; loss of ozone also cools the stratosphere. In the stratosphere, two warm spots over Antarctica and the Arctic appear to defy the overall cooling trend. One explanation for these warm spots is that polar stratospheric temperatures can fluctuate widely. The poles, especially the Arctic, experience periodic events known as sudden stratospheric warmings, during which the vortex of winds that circles the poles breaks down. When this happens, the stratosphere can warm several tens of degrees Celsius in a few days. Although these events are more common in the Arctic, a significant sudden stratospheric warming also occurred in the Antarctic stratosphere in 2002 and may help explain the apparent warming trend. Whether the localized warming trend is significant is still uncertain.

The measurements were taken by Microwave Sounding Units and Advanced Microwave Sounding Units flying on a series of National Oceanic and Atmospheric Administration (NOAA) weather satellites. The instruments record microwave energy emitted from oxygen molecules in the atmosphere. Warmer molecules release more energy than cooler molecules, so scientists can measure the temperature of the atmosphere by recording the amount of microwave energy being emitted. Early analyses of these measurements showed little or no warming in the troposphere, where models predicted that warming should be occurring. For a time, these measurements caused some people to question the validity of global climate models and greenhouse gas warming. Scientists discovered, however, that the satellites carrying the microwave instruments had drifted in their orbits over time, so that more recent measurements were taken at a different time of day than older measurements. Once scientists accounted for this bias and other differences between the individual instruments, the measurements showed a warming trend in the troposphere, consistent with surface observations of rising global temperature.

Re-analysis of the satellite measurements answered one of the frequently asked questions about global warming: why didn’t the early satellite data show warming in the lower layer of the atmosphere? Polio is caused by a virus. No one is sure exactly where it came from, or why it wasn’t more widespread prior to the 20th century. It well may be that it was around, but harmless, until a 20th century mutation caused it to become deadly. In any case, we know it’s a virus, and that’s why and how the vaccines worked against it. It’s not caused by chemical exposure, though some exposures may insult human immune systems and make some people more prone to get the disease the virus causes.

2. We know it wasn’t DDT, too. DDT was not available for use against insects by anyone prior to 1942. Polio was rampant before then (my brother caught polio in 1939). DDT was not available for use outside the military prior to 1946.

3. Diseases cured by medical care? Streps and bacterial infections, including tuberculosis (save for the drug-resistant kinds). Leukemia. Measles, almost. Polio wasn’t counted as eradicated until very recently (if at all). Goiter and iodine deficiency ($0.15 per ton of salt to “iodize” it, and cure goiter; the cheapest public health action ever).

4. Do you want to know how good cures work? The American Dental Association pushed for fluoridation to help prevent and cure dental caries. It worked fantastically. Now dentists spend more time fixing other stuff, and dental caries is basically a disease of the past — except for those people who don’t take care of their teeth or have some other special weakness to decay. First, malaria fighters stopped using DDT heavily in Africa in the early 1960s, years before any nation banned the substance.  There were three problems that contributed to the cessation of DDT use, as outlined by Malcolm Gladwell in his heavily researched and authoritative tribute to malaria fighter Fred Soper in The New Yorker:

  1. Many nations in Africa did have governments capable of conducting the regimented campaign necessary to successfully eradicate malaria — and in fact, most of the nations in Subsaharan Africa didn’t participate in the campaign at all.  Soper’s goal was to knock down mosquitoes for at least six months, and in that time cure malaria in every human.  When the mosquitoes came roaring back — as everyone in the program knew they would — there would be no pool of malaria in humans from which the mosquitoes could get infected.  The program was to break the chain of transmission required for the life cycles of the malaria parasites.  But that meant that governments had to have health care systems that could accurately diagnose malaria, and often which malaria parasite, and complete a cycle of treatment needed to flush the parasites out of the infected humans.  In the end, many entire nations simply did not participate.
  2. Malaria fighters were well aware of the race they were running:  Mosquitoes breed quickly, and consequently evolve quickly.  WHO’s malaria fighting teams understood it was a simply matter of time before mosquitoes became resistant or immune to DDT.  If that happened before malaria could be eradicated in a country or region, the game was over.  Resistance to DDT in mosquitoes started showing up as early as 1948 in Greece; by the 1960s several populations of mosquitoes were highly resistant.  (Today, every mosquito on Earth carries at least one of the two alleles that produces DDT immunity — and some carry as many as 60 copies of the two alleles, leaving them completely unaffected by DDT.)
  3. Industry didn’t get on board with the campaign.  Over-use of DDT out of doors by agricultural interests speeded the evolution of DDT-resistant mosquitoes.  Industrial use competed against, and ultimately frustrated, health care use of DDT.

Gladwell describes how WHO abandoned the eradication campaign with DDT as the key element, in the middle 1960s.  This was done not as a reaction to Carson’s book, but because the mosquitoes showed resistance.  Malaria fighters couldn’t build medical care in several nations at once while racing agriculture to use DDT.  WHO turned to other methods of fighting the parasites.

It’s important to note that WHO cannot dictate to nations what they do, nor did WHO ever “ban” DDT.  There are a lot of claims that there was pressure applied by environmentalists to get DDT use stopped, but the facts remain that DDT manufacture for export to Africa continued in the United States for more than a decade after DDT use was stopped in the U.S.  Manufacture of DDT moved to Africa and Asia — India and China make the stuff today.  Any African nation who wished to use DDT could have gotten it cheaply and in great quantity.

Second, there is no indication that DDT could have saved any more lives.  Simple mathematics tells the story:  The WHO eradication campaign reduced world-wide deaths from a high of 4 million annually, to about 2 million annually.  Each nation that eradicated malaria did so by raising incomes and improving the housing of poor people, making effective screening from mosquitoes the central part of the campaign.  Also, nations copied what the U.S. had done prior to the discovery that DDT killed insects:  They institute improved public health campaigns to educate people how to avoid being bitten, and to diagnose the disease and deliver knock-out pharmaceuticals quickly.

But, since heavy DDT use was stopped, the malaria rates continued to fall until recently.  Over the last decade, annual deaths numbered under a million, lower than when DDT use was at its greatest.  It’s impossible to square decreasing death rates with Monckton’s claim that DDT is a panacea against malaria, still.

Finally to this point of DDT and malaria, we have a conundrum:  Those nations who still use DDT, still have epidemic malaria.  If, as Monckton says, DDT is a miracle weapon against malaria, those nations that use DDT should be malaria-free.  If we think through the process, we see that malaria eradication is a much greater task that simply killing mosquitoes, and too complex to be cured simply by poisoning Africa and Africans.

Ultimately, the decisions to reduce the use of, and now to phase out DDT (under 2001’s Persistent Organic Pesticides Treaty (POPs)) were scientific decisions.  In the U.S., the National Academy of Sciences wrote about DDT early on, noting (with an egregious typographical error) the great utility and benefit DDT provides to humans, but finally weighing the harmful effects and finding that they outweigh the benefits.  The number of assessments of DDT by august scientific and policy bodies is impressive, each deciding DDT had to go:  The 1958 U.S. Forest Service, the 1963 President’s Science Advisory Council, two federal courts in the U.S., the Food and Drug Administration in 1969, the U.S. Environmental Protection Agency in 1972, two more federal appellate courts ruling on the appropriateness and scientific soundness of EPA’s rule, the National Academy of Sciences, Congress under the Resource Conservation and Recovery Act (RCRA, the Superfund Act), and finally an international treaty between nearly 100 nations.  At each step science was the driving force.  At most steps, an absence of sound science would have made the ruling go the opposite way.

The light bulb.  It’s an incandescent bulb.

It wasn’t the first bulb.  Edison a few months earlier devised a bulb that worked with a platinum filament.  Platinum was too expensive for mass production, though — and Edison wanted mass production.  So, with the cadre of great assistants at his Menlo Park laboratories, he struggled to find a good, inexpensive filament that would provide adequate life for the bulb.  By late December 1879 they had settled on carbon filament.

Edison invited investors and the public to see the bulb demonstrated, on December 31, 1879.

Thomas Edison in 1878, the year before he demonstrated a workable electric light bulb.  Library of Congress image

Thomas Edison in 1878, the year before he demonstrated a workable electric light bulb. CREDIT: Thomas Edison, head-and-shoulders portrait, facing left, 1880. Prints and Photographs Division, Library of Congress. Reproduction number LC-USZ62-98067

Edison’s successful bulb indicated changes in science, technology, invention, intellectual property and finance well beyond its use of electricity. For example:

  • Edison’s Menlo Park, New Jersey, offices and laboratory were financed with earlier successful inventions.  It was a hive of inventive activity aimed to make practical inventions from advances in science.  Edison was all about selling inventions and rights to manufacture devices.  He always had an eye on the profit potential.  His improvements on the telegraph would found his laboratory he thought, and he expected to sell the device to Western Union for $5,000 to $7,000.  Instead of offering it to them at a price, however, he asked Western Union to bid on it.  They bid $10,000, which Edison gratefully accepted, along with the lesson that he might do better letting the marketplace establish the price for his inventions.  Other inventive labs followed Edison’s example, such as the famous Bell Labs, but few equalled his success, or had as much fun doing it.
  • While Edison had some financial weight to invest in the quest for a workable electric light, he also got financial support, $30,000 worth, from some of the finance giants of the day, including J. P. Morgan and the Vanderbilts who established the Edison Light Company.
  • Edison didn’t invent the light bulb — but his improvements on it made it commercial.  “In addressing the question ‘Who invented the incandescent lamp?’ historians Robert Friedel and Paul Israel list 22 inventors of incandescent lamps prior to Joseph Wilson Swan and Thomas Edison. They conclude that Edison’s version was able to outstrip the others because of a combination of three factors: an effective incandescent material, a higher vacuum than others were able to achieve (by use of the Sprengel pump) and a high resistance lamp that made power distribution from a centralized source economically viable.”
  • Edison’s financial and business leadership acumen is partly attested to by the continuance of his organizations, today — General Electric, one of the world’s most successful companies over the past 40 years, traces its origins to Edison.

December 30, 1924, Edwin Hubble announced the results of his observations of distant objects in space.

PBS

Edwin Hubble - source: PBS

In 1924, he announced the discovery of a Cepheid, or variable star, in the Andromeda Nebulae. Since the work of Henrietta Leavitt had made it possible to calculate the distance to Cepheids, he calculated that this Cepheid was much further away than anyone had thought and that therefore the nebulae was not a gaseous cloud inside our galaxy, like so many nebulae, but in fact, a galaxy of stars just like the Milky Way. Only much further away. Until now, people believed that the only thing existing outside the Milky Way were the Magellanic Clouds. The Universe was much bigger than had been previously presumed.

Later Hubble noted that the universe demonstrates a “red-shift phenomenon.” The universe is expanding. This led to the idea of an initial expansion event, and the theory eventually known as Big Bang.

Hubble’s life offered several surprises, and firsts:

Hubble was a tall, elegant, athletic, man who at age 30 had an undergraduate degree in astronomy and mathematics, a legal degree as a Rhodes scholar, followed by a PhD in astronomy. He was an attorney in Kentucky (joined its bar in 1913), and had served in WWI, rising to the rank of major. He was bored with law and decided to go back to his studies in astronomy.

In 1919 he began to work at Mt. Wilson Observatory in California, where he would work for the rest of his life. . . .
Hubble wanted to classify the galaxies according to their content, distance, shape, and brightness patterns, and in his observations he made another momentous discovery: By observing redshifts in the light wavelengths emitted by the galaxies, he saw that galaxies were moving away from each other at a rate constant to the distance between them (Hubble’s Law). The further away they were, the faster they receded. This led to the calculation of the point where the expansion began, and confirmation of the big bang theory. Hubble calculated it to be about 2 billion years ago, but more recent estimates have revised that to 20 billion years ago.

An active anti-fascist, Hubble wanted to joined the armed forces again during World War II, but was convinced he could contribute more as a scientist on the homefront. When the 200-inch telescope was completed on Mt. Palomar, Hubble was given the honor of first use. He died in 1953.

“Equipped with his five senses, man explores the universe around him and calls the adventure Science.”

That news on December 30, 1924, didn’t make the first page of the New York Times. The Times carried a small note on February 25, 1925, that Hubble won a $1,000 prize from the American Academy for the Advancement of Science.

Ships pour out great quantities of pollutants into the air in the form of sulphur and nitrogen oxides.

The emissions from ships engaged in international trade in the seas surrounding Europe – the Baltic, the North Sea, the north-eastern part of the Atlantic, the Mediterranean and the Black Sea – were estimated to have been 2.3 million tonnes of sulphur dioxide and 3.3 million tonnes of nitrogen oxides a year in 2000.

In contrast to the progress in reducing emissions from land-based sources, shipping emissions of sulphur and nitrogen oxides are expected to continue increasing by 40-50 per cent up to 2020. In both cases, by 2020 the emissions from international shipping around Europe will have surpassed the total from all land-based sources in the 27 EU member states combined.

The PBSG renewed the conclusion from previous meetings that the greatest challenge to conservation of polar bears is ecological change in the Arctic resulting from climatic warming.  Declines in the extent of the sea ice have accelerated since the last meeting of the group in 2005, with unprecedented sea ice retreats in 2007 and 2008. The PBSG confirmed its earlier conclusion that unabated global warming will ultimately threaten polar bears everywhere.

The PBSG also recognized that threats to polar bears will occur at different rates and times across their range although warming induced habitat degradation and loss are already negatively affecting polar bears in some parts of their range. Subpopulations of polar bears face different combinations of human threats.  The PBSG recommends that jurisdictions take into account the variation in threats facing polar bears.

The PBSG noted polar bears suffer health effects from persistent pollutants.  At the same time, climate change appears to be altering the pathways by which such pollutants enter ecosystems. The PBSG encourages international efforts to evaluate interactions between climate change and pollutants.

The PBSG endorses efforts to develop non-invasive means of population assessment, and continues to encourage jurisdictions to incorporate capture and radio tracking programs into their national monitoring efforts. The members also recognized that aboriginal people are both uniquely positioned to observe wildlife and changes in the environment, and their knowledge is essential for effective management.
